Abstract

In few-shot learning, adapting foundation models has emerged as a powerful approach to bridge the gap between limited task-specific data and the rich knowledge encoded in pre-trained models. Existing adaptation methods based on CLIP primarily focus on improving the network architecture to enhance the learning ability, which has been proven to cause overfitting and reduce generalizability, but overlook the influence of data augmentation. In this work, we first analyze the differences between our work and previous work from the perspective of probability theory. Then, we concentrate on data augmentation and propose innovative Cross-Modal Mixup methods designed to enhance the model's cross-modal reasoning and classification capabilities, as well as its overall generalization. Specifically, based on dimensions match or not, the Cross-Modal Mixup methods comprise two forms: Cross Mixup (CM) for data augmentation with features of the same dimension, and Cross Expand Mixup (CEM) with features of different dimensions. Extensive experiments have demonstrated the effectiveness of our CM and CEM.
